198 Monitor Street is a condominium building built in 2005 in Brooklyn with 6 residential units. It carries a Grade A health score — one of the cleaner records in its peer group, with no open violations or active complaints. Our analysis reviewed 30 records across 25 public data sources, benchmarked against similar mid-sized postwar residential buildings in NYC.
HPD confirmed a finding of tenant harassment against this building's owner with a $2,000 penalty. See the for details.
